Type | Liquid Chromatography (LC) System |
Detector | Available (various models, including VWD, DAD, FLD, MWD, RID, ELSD, MS) |
Software | OpenLab CDS or ChemStation |
pH Range | 1-13 (column dependent) |
Injection Volume Range | 0.1 – 100 μL (depending on autosampler) |
Detector Type | Variable Wavelength Detector (VWD), Diode Array Detector (DAD) |
Wavelength Range (VWD) | 190 to 600 nm |
Wavelength Range (DAD) | 190 - 950 nm |
Data Handling | Agilent OpenLab CDS |
Pump Type | Binary, Quaternary, Isocratic (depending on model) |
